  1. Pharmacy technicians are medical professionals who work with pharmacists to help patients and make sure they get the best care. They often are the people who find, package, and label prescribed medications. Their work is then checked by pharmacists.

Pharmacy Technology programs can prepare you to be a pharmacy technician, who works under the supervision of a pharmacist to help distribute prescription medications to customers and health professionals. Pharmacy technicians are detail-oriented individuals with excellent people and organizational skills.
    Those enthusiastic about exploring pharmacy technician careers can start by contacting the American Society of Health-System Pharmacists in Bethesda, Maryland for a set of accredited pharmacy technician programs.
    You don’t need to be certified as a pharmacy technician, but certification can make it easier to find a job. Some employers will even pay for you to become certified. The California State Board of Pharmacy also accepts a PTCB certification as adequate proof of pharmacy education.
